lewis dot structure calculator


lewis dot structure calculator

A smart tool to visualize molecular bonding and electron arrangements.


Enter a valid molecular formula. For ions, use +/- (e.g., NH4+, SO4-2).


Lewis Structure Diagram

What is a lewis dot structure calculator?

A lewis dot structure calculator is a digital tool designed to automatically generate the Lewis structure for a given molecule or ion. Lewis structures, also known as Lewis dot formulas or electron dot structures, are two-dimensional diagrams that show the connectivity of atoms in a molecule, as well as the lone pairs of electrons that may exist. They are a fundamental concept in chemistry, crucial for understanding covalent bonding, molecular geometry, and predicting chemical reactivity. This calculator simplifies the often complex, rule-based process of drawing these structures by hand.

This tool is invaluable for students learning chemistry, educators creating teaching materials, and researchers who need a quick visualization of a molecule’s bonding pattern. By simply inputting a chemical formula, users can bypass the manual steps of counting valence electrons, identifying the central atom, and distributing electrons, thereby avoiding common errors.

The Lewis Structure Formula and Explanation

Drawing a Lewis structure is not based on a single mathematical formula but on a systematic procedure. The goal is to arrange the atoms and electrons to satisfy the octet rule (or duet rule for hydrogen), which states that atoms tend to bond in such a way that they each have eight electrons in their valence shell. The lewis dot structure calculator automates this process.

An important related calculation is for Formal Charge, which helps determine the most plausible Lewis structure among several possibilities. The structure with formal charges closest to zero is generally preferred.

The formula for formal charge on an atom is:
Formal Charge = (Valence Electrons) - (Non-Bonding Electrons) - (1/2 * Bonding Electrons)

Formula Variables
Variable Meaning Unit Typical Range
Valence Electrons (VE) The number of electrons in an atom’s outermost shell. Electrons 1-8 for main group elements
Non-Bonding Electrons Electrons in an atom’s valence shell that are not involved in bonding (lone pair electrons). Electrons 0, 2, 4, 6, 8
Bonding Electrons Electrons shared between two atoms in covalent bonds. Electrons 2, 4, 6, 8+

Practical Examples

Let’s walk through how the calculator determines the structure for a few common molecules.

Example 1: Water (H₂O)

  • Inputs: Formula = H₂O
  • Process:
    1. Total Valence Electrons: 1 (from H) * 2 + 6 (from O) = 8 electrons.
    2. Central Atom: Oxygen is the central atom as hydrogen can only form one bond.
    3. Single bonds are drawn from O to each H, using 4 electrons.
    4. The remaining 4 electrons are placed on the Oxygen atom as two lone pairs.
  • Results: The structure shows an Oxygen atom bonded to two Hydrogen atoms, with two lone pairs on the Oxygen. The octet rule is satisfied for Oxygen, and the duet rule for Hydrogen.

Example 2: Carbon Dioxide (CO₂)

  • Inputs: Formula = CO₂
  • Process:
    1. Total Valence Electrons: 4 (from C) + 6 (from O) * 2 = 16 electrons.
    2. Central Atom: Carbon is less electronegative than Oxygen and is the central atom.
    3. Single bonds are drawn (O-C-O), using 4 electrons. The remaining 12 are distributed to the Oxygen atoms (6 each).
    4. The central Carbon atom only has 4 electrons. To satisfy its octet, one lone pair from each Oxygen forms a double bond with Carbon.
  • Results: The final structure is O=C=O, with two lone pairs on each Oxygen atom. All atoms satisfy the octet rule, and all formal charges are zero.

How to Use This lewis dot structure calculator

Using this calculator is straightforward. Follow these simple steps to generate a Lewis structure for your molecule or ion of interest.

  1. Enter the Chemical Formula: Type the molecular formula into the input field. For example, for methane, you would type CH4. The calculator is case-sensitive for element symbols (e.g., ‘Co’ for Cobalt, ‘CO’ for Carbon Monoxide).
  2. Handle Ions: If you are working with a polyatomic ion, indicate the charge using + or -. For a positive charge, add + followed by the number (e.g., NH4+). For a negative charge, use - (e.g., SO4-2).
  3. Click Calculate: Press the “Calculate Structure” button to run the algorithm.
  4. Interpret the Results:
    • The main display will show a dynamic SVG drawing of the Lewis structure. Atoms are represented by their chemical symbols, bonds by lines, and lone pair electrons by dots.
    • Below the diagram, you’ll find a breakdown of the total valence electrons, bonding pairs, and lone pairs.
    • A table will display the calculated formal charge for each atom in the structure, helping you assess its stability.
  5. Reset for a New Calculation: Click the “Reset” button to clear all fields and results to start over with a new molecule.

Key Factors That Affect Lewis Structures

Several chemical principles govern the final form of a Lewis structure. Understanding them helps in interpreting the calculator’s output.

  • Octet Rule: The primary driving principle. Most atoms (especially in the second period) strive to have 8 valence electrons. Our {related_keywords} provides more detail on electron shells.
  • Exceptions to the Octet Rule: Some elements are stable with fewer or more than 8 electrons.
    • Incomplete Octet: Elements like Boron (B) and Beryllium (Be) are often stable with 6 or 4 valence electrons, respectively.
    • Expanded Octet: Elements in the third period and below (like P, S, Cl) can accommodate more than 8 electrons in their valence shell by utilizing their d-orbitals.
  • Electronegativity: This property helps in determining the central atom of a molecule—it’s typically the least electronegative element (excluding hydrogen). Check out our {related_keywords} for more on this topic.
  • Formal Charge: A tool used to determine the most stable Lewis structure when multiple arrangements are possible. Structures with formal charges closest to zero are more favorable.
  • Resonance: For some molecules, a single Lewis structure is insufficient to describe the bonding. A set of resonance structures (multiple valid Lewis diagrams) is used instead, where the true structure is an average of the resonance hybrids. Our {related_keywords} explores this concept.
  • Polyatomic Ions: The total electron count must be adjusted for the charge of an ion. Negative ions have extra electrons, and positive ions have fewer electrons.

Frequently Asked Questions (FAQ)

1. How does the calculator choose the central atom?

The calculator generally selects the least electronegative atom as the central atom. Hydrogen and Halogens (like F, Cl) are typically terminal (outer) atoms unless they are the only other option.

2. What is an ‘expanded octet’ and how is it handled?

An expanded octet occurs when a central atom has more than eight valence electrons. This is possible for elements in period 3 or below because they have access to d-orbitals. The calculator allows for this when appropriate, for example, in molecules like SF₆.

3. Why is my molecule showing non-zero formal charges?

While a formal charge of zero on all atoms is ideal, it’s not always possible, especially in polyatomic ions or certain neutral molecules. The best Lewis structure is the one that minimizes the magnitude of the formal charges. The {related_keywords} can help visualize this balance.

4. What are resonance structures?

Resonance occurs when more than one valid Lewis structure can be drawn for a molecule. The actual structure is a hybrid or average of these different resonance forms. This calculator currently shows one of the most stable resonance structures, but it’s important to recognize when others might exist.

5. Does this calculator handle all chemical compounds?

This tool is designed for a wide range of common covalent compounds and polyatomic ions. However, it may not perfectly represent complex coordination compounds, metallic bonding, or molecules with very unusual bonding patterns. It is best used for main group elements.

6. How are double and triple bonds determined?

After single bonds are formed and lone pairs are distributed, the calculator checks if the central atom has a complete octet. If not, it converts lone pairs from adjacent atoms into double or triple bonds until the central atom’s octet is satisfied.

7. What happens if I enter an element the calculator doesn’t recognize?

The calculator has a built-in library of common elements and their valence electron counts. If you enter a symbol that isn’t in its database or a nonsensical formula, it will display an error message prompting you to correct the input.

8. Can I use this for ionic compounds like NaCl?

Lewis structures are primarily used to represent covalent bonding (electron sharing). For simple ionic compounds like NaCl, the bonding involves a transfer of electrons, not sharing. While you can draw a Lewis diagram for the resulting ions (Na⁺ and [Cl]⁻), this calculator is optimized for covalently bonded molecules.

Related Tools and Internal Resources

Explore more of our chemistry tools and articles to deepen your understanding of molecular structures and properties.

  • {related_keywords}: Learn how electrons are configured within atomic orbitals.
  • {related_keywords}: A tool to calculate and compare the electronegativity of different elements.
  • {related_keywords}: Explore how molecules with multiple valid Lewis structures are represented.
  • {related_keywords}: Predict the 3D shape of molecules based on their Lewis structure.
  • {related_keywords}: Calculate the mass of a molecule based on its chemical formula.
  • {related_keywords}: A fundamental tool for any chemistry calculation, providing essential element data.

© 2026 Your Website. All rights reserved. This lewis dot structure calculator is for educational purposes.



Leave a Reply

Your email address will not be published. Required fields are marked *